How do you write the And?

Most people begin their ampersand at the baseline, in order to start at the bottom tail of the symbol. On ruled or lined paper, the baseline is the bottom of the two lines that make up the writing area. You should start just a tiny bit to the right of where you want the symbol to go.

Why are there 2 ways to write a?

Ultimately, there is no singular, inciting event or decision, no defining secret origin that created two commonly accepted forms of the lowercase letter “a”—”a” and “α.” The forms developed along with the printed word, as manuscripts, books and other documents moved from being handwritten to being produced mechanically …

What is the symbol * called?

In English, the symbol * is generally called asterisk. Depending on the context, the asterisk symbol has different meanings. In Math, for instance, the asterisk symbol is used for multiplication of two numbers, let’s say 4 * 5; in this case, the asterisk is voiced ‘times,’ making it “4 times 5”.

What is the name of this symbol @?

Originally Answered: What is the name of the “@” symbol? Unlike the other symbols (ampersand, parentheses, etc.) “@” does not have a specific name in English. It is merely called the “at sign” or “at symbol.” It originated as a shortcut for scribes writing the Latin word “ad” meaning at…

How A is written?

Its name in English is a (pronounced /ˈeɪ/), plural aes. The lowercase version can be written in two forms: the double-storey a and single-storey ɑ.
